Dispensary Cannabis Loyalty Programs Are They Worth It?

In recent years, cannabis dispensaries have been adopting the kind of loyalty programs that big retailers and coffee chains have perfected. From points-per-purchase systems to VIP rewards, these programs aim to keep customers coming back. But if you’re a cannabis consumer, you might wonder: are these loyalty programs actually worth your time, or are they just marketing gimmicks?

The truth is, when used wisely, dispensary cannabis loyalty programs can provide real value — not just in discounts, but also in personalized experiences and exclusive perks. Here’s a closer look at how they work and whether they’re worth joining.

1. How Cannabis Loyalty Programs Work

Most dispensary loyalty programs operate on a simple points system. Every dollar you spend earns you points, which can later be redeemed for discounts, free products, or special promotions. Some programs offer tiered membership levels, where frequent shoppers gain access to bigger rewards, exclusive products, or early access to new strains.

Beyond points, some dispensaries provide perks such as birthday gifts, invitations to private events, or members-only educational sessions. In short, loyalty programs are designed to reward customers for consistency while creating a sense of community and exclusivity.

2. Saving Money on Your Favorite Strains

The most obvious benefit of a loyalty program is savings. Cannabis can be expensive, especially for medical patients who require regular use. Loyalty points can turn your everyday purchases into tangible rewards — sometimes as simple as a free pre-roll after a certain number of purchases, or a discount on a high-THC flower you’ve been eyeing.

For frequent shoppers, these rewards can add up quickly. If you already purchase cannabis regularly, joining a loyalty program is essentially like getting a small percentage back on every purchase, which is money saved you can put toward trying new products or experimenting with concentrates, edibles, or tinctures.

3. Early Access and Exclusive Deals

Another hidden benefit of dispensary loyalty programs is early access to new strains or limited-edition products. Cannabis companies often release special strains in small batches, and being part of a loyalty program can ensure you’re among the first to try them.

Some programs also offer members-only promotions or flash sales. For consumers who like exploring new products or discovering rare cultivars, loyalty programs provide a real edge. These perks can make your shopping experience feel more like an exclusive club rather than a routine purchase.

4. Personalized Recommendations and Education

Modern dispensary loyalty programs often go beyond points and discounts. Many programs track your purchase history to offer personalized recommendations, helping you discover products that fit your preferences, whether it’s a new Indica for relaxation or a CBD-rich tincture for anxiety.

Additionally, some dispensaries provide loyalty members with access to educational workshops, strain guides, or expert consultations. These resources are especially valuable for beginners who want to navigate the world of cannabis safely and effectively. It turns a loyalty program from a simple discount scheme into a learning and discovery platform.

5. Are There Any Drawbacks?

Of course, loyalty programs aren’t without limitations. Some programs may have expiration dates on points, minimum purchase requirements, or restrictions on which products can be redeemed. Others may encourage unnecessary spending, leading consumers to buy more than they actually need.

It’s also worth noting that some dispensaries require personal information, such as email addresses or phone numbers, which may be used for marketing purposes. While this is common in retail, privacy-conscious consumers may want to read the terms carefully before signing up.

6. Making the Most of Your Loyalty Program

To truly benefit from a cannabis loyalty program, approach it with strategy. First, join programs at dispensaries you already frequent. This ensures you earn rewards on purchases you’d make anyway. Second, pay attention to points expiration and redemption rules to avoid losing benefits.

Finally, use the perks as intended — whether it’s trying a new strain, attending an educational event, or stocking up on your favorite flower. A well-used loyalty program can enhance your cannabis experience, save you money, and even introduce you to products you might not have discovered otherwise.

7. Are Cannabis Loyalty Programs Worth It?

The short answer: yes — but with conditions. If you shop at the dispensary regularly, enjoy exploring new products, and appreciate personalized recommendations, loyalty programs are worth the effort. They can save money, provide unique experiences, and foster a closer connection with the dispensary community.

For casual or infrequent users, the benefits may be limited, but signing up doesn’t hurt. At worst, you get occasional offers and discounts; at best, you unlock a treasure trove of perks that enhance your Baltimore dispensary journey.

Final Thoughts

Cannabis loyalty programs are more than marketing tools — they’re gateways to better experiences, smarter shopping, and deeper engagement with the dispensary community. By understanding the perks, reading the fine print, and using rewards strategically, you can turn routine purchases into meaningful benefits.

Whether you’re a daily medical user or a recreational explorer, a dispensary loyalty program can be a valuable ally in making every cannabis purchase more rewarding.

Cardiology: Understanding the Heart and Advancements in Cardiac CareCardiology: Understanding the Heart and Advancements in Cardiac Care

Cardiology, the medical field dedicated to diagnosing, treating, and preventing heart-related diseases, is at the forefront of healthcare due to the central role the heart plays in overall well-being. The heart is responsible for pumping blood throughout the body, ensuring that oxygen and essential nutrients reach every cell. As heart disease remains one of the leading causes of death worldwide, cardiology continues to evolve with new diagnostic tools, treatment methods, and preventive strategies that aim to reduce the burden of cardiovascular illnesses.

The Importance of Heart Health

The human heart is an extraordinary organ. Comprised of four chambers, it pumps blood through a complex network of blood vessels, ensuring the body’s tissues receive a constant supply of oxygen and nutrients. Without the heart’s continuous function, the body cannot sustain life. Unfortunately, due to genetics, lifestyle choices, and environmental factors, the heart is also susceptible to a wide range of diseases that can affect its efficiency.

These conditions can range from minor issues, such as high blood pressure or irregular heartbeats, to life-threatening conditions, such as heart attacks, heart failure, and arrhythmias. Understanding the underlying causes of these diseases and how to address them is vital, and that’s where cardiology plays a crucial role.

Key Heart Diseases and Conditions

Cardiology addresses a variety of heart-related conditions. Some of the most common heart diseases include:

  1. Coronary Artery Disease (CAD): CAD is one of the most common forms of heart disease. It occurs when plaque—made up of fat, cholesterol, and other substances—builds up in the coronary arteries, narrowing them and limiting blood flow to the heart muscle. This can lead to chest pain (angina), heart attacks, and heart failure. CAD is often managed through lifestyle changes, medications, and interventions such as angioplasty or coronary artery bypass surgery.

  2. Heart Failure: This condition arises when the heart is unable to pump blood effectively, leading to fluid buildup in the lungs, abdomen, and lower extremities. While heart failure is a chronic condition, with proper management through medication, lifestyle changes, and occasionally, surgeries like heart transplants, patients can often live with heart failure for many years.

  3. Arrhythmias: These are irregular heart rhythms that can either cause the heart to beat too fast (tachycardia), too slow (bradycardia), or in an irregular pattern. Arrhythmias can lead to dizziness, fainting, or more severe outcomes, such as strokes. Common arrhythmias include atrial fibrillation and ventricular fibrillation, and treatments may involve medications, pacemakers, or surgical interventions.

  4. Valvular Heart Disease: The heart contains four valves that ensure blood flows in one direction through its chambers. When these valves become damaged or diseased, they can lead to heart murmurs, shortness of breath, or even heart failure. In some cases, valvular heart disease may require valve replacement surgery or other interventions.

  5. Hypertension (High Blood Pressure): Often referred to as the "silent killer," high blood pressure can cause significant damage to the heart and blood vessels. It increases the risk of heart attack, stroke, and kidney failure. Managing hypertension through medication, exercise, and dietary changes is crucial for reducing these risks.

  6. Congenital Heart Defects: These are heart defects that are present at birth. Some of these conditions may be minor and require no treatment, while others may necessitate surgery or long-term management. Pediatric cardiologists specialize in diagnosing and treating congenital heart conditions, ensuring children with these conditions can lead healthy lives.

The Role of Cardiologists in Heart Care

Cardiologists are specialized physicians who are trained to manage a wide range of heart diseases. They diagnose heart conditions through physical exams, lab tests, imaging studies (such as echocardiograms and stress tests), and other diagnostic procedures like angiograms. Cardiologists also guide patients in preventing heart disease by offering lifestyle advice, managing risk factors like high cholesterol, and prescribing medications when necessary.

Specialized areas within cardiology include:

  • Interventional Cardiology: These cardiologists focus on using catheter-based techniques to treat coronary artery disease, including procedures like angioplasty and stent placements to open blocked arteries.

  • Electrophysiology: This subfield is concerned with diagnosing and treating arrhythmias. Electrophysiologists perform procedures like catheter ablation to correct abnormal heart rhythms.

  • Pediatric Cardiology: Pediatric cardiologists specialize in diagnosing and treating heart conditions in children, including congenital heart defects and other cardiovascular conditions that may arise in childhood.

  • Preventive Cardiology: Cardiologists in this area work with patients to identify and mitigate risk factors for heart disease, such as obesity, smoking, high blood pressure, and diabetes, through lifestyle modifications and regular screenings.

The field of cardiology has seen significant advancements over the past few decades, largely due to technological innovations. Some of the most important breakthroughs include:

  1. Cardiac Imaging: Advanced imaging techniques, such as magnetic resonance imaging (MRI), computed tomography (CT), and echocardiography, provide cardiologists with detailed, non-invasive images of the heart. These imaging tools help in the diagnosis of heart diseases and the planning of surgeries and interventions.

  2. Minimally Invasive Procedures: Interventional cardiology has made great strides in allowing cardiologists to treat heart disease using minimally invasive techniques. Procedures like angioplasty, where a balloon is used to open up blocked arteries, or transcatheter aortic valve replacement (TAVR) for patients with severe valve disease, have reduced the need for open-heart surgery and shortened recovery times.

  3. Wearable Technology: The rise of wearable devices like fitness trackers and smartwatches has enabled patients to monitor their heart rate, blood pressure, and other vital signs in real time. Some devices even alert users to irregular heart rhythms, making it easier to detect problems early and intervene before serious complications arise.

  4.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ning: AI is making waves in cardiology by helping clinicians analyze medical data more efficiently. AI algorithms are now being used to interpret heart imaging, predict patient outcomes, and provide personalized treatment plans. Machine learning can assist in detecting conditions like heart disease at earlier stages, improving prognosis and treatment success.

  5. Gene Therapy and Stem Cell Research: Cutting-edge research into gene therapy and stem cell treatments holds the potential to revolutionize how heart disease is treated. Gene therapy could potentially correct genetic defects that cause congenital heart conditions, while stem cell therapies might enable the regeneration of damaged heart tissue, offering hope for patients with heart failure or other chronic conditions.

Preventing Heart Disease: Lifestyle and Risk Factors

One of the key focuses of cardiology today is prevention. Many heart diseases can be prevented or managed with proper lifestyle changes and routine check-ups. Cardiologists emphasize the importance of:

  • Regular Exercise: Cardiologists recommend at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ise per week. Physical activity strengthens the heart, lowers blood pressure, improves cholesterol levels, and helps with weight management.

  • Heart-Healthy Diet: A bal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ats can reduce the risk of heart disease. Cardiologists often recommend the Mediterranean diet, which has been shown to benefit heart health.

  • Smoking Cessation: Smoking is a major contributor to heart disease, and quitting smoking reduces the risk of heart attack, stroke, and other cardiovascular diseases. Cardiologists provide support and resources for patients who wish to quit.

  • Stress Management: Chronic stress can lead to high blood pressure and other risk factors for heart disease. Cardiologists encourage patients to find effective ways to manage stress, such as through meditation, yoga, and mindfulness practices.

  • Routine Check-Ups: Regular check-ups allow for early detection of risk factors like high blood pressure, high cholesterol, and diabetes. Cardiologists recommend regular screenings and preventive care to catch potential heart problems early.

The Future of Cardiology

The future of cardiology is bright, with innovations in technology, research, and patient care paving the way for more effective treatments and better patient outcomes. As gene therapy, AI, and wearable technologies continue to advance, cardiologists will be able to provide more personalized care tailored to the specific needs of individual patients.

As the global burden of heart disease continues to rise, cardiology’s role in prevention, early detection, and cutting-edge treatments will remain crucial in improving public health. Through continued research, education, and innovation, the future of cardiology holds the promise of a world with healthier hearts and longer lives.

Conclusion

Cardiology plays a central role in modern healthcare, as heart disease remains one of the most common and devastating medical conditions worldwide. With a focus on early detection, innovative treatments, and preventive care, cardiologists are working tirelessly to reduce the impact of heart disease. As technological advancements continue to revolutionize the field, the future of cardiology promises to deliver even more effective solutions for heart health. Through a combination of medical expertise and patient engagement, cardiology is helping millions of people live longer, healthier lives.
